TitleLetter. Mr Warberg (4 Child's Place, Temple Bar, London) to M. Boulton (----)
LevelItem
Date7 April 1804
Description['Our Government has approved of Your proposal respecting the Engine to work a forge without rolling... Your regulation for the mint machines is likewise agreed to with the exception of the large rolling mill.' Still awaiting news of the application for an Act of Parliament to export the mint machines. Sir Joseph Banks says bother steam engines can be exported without permission.]
